Urine drug tests detect specific metabolites (byproducts of drug breakdown) and compare them to laboratory cutoff thresholds, not to whether you used a “detox” product.
A standard 5-panel or 10-panel urine screen typically includes tests for substances such as THC, cocaine, opiates, amphetamines, and sometimes benzodiazepines and others.
“Herbal Clean” isn’t a single active ingredient across all markets—formulas differ by country and product line—so the only reliable way to understand what you’re ingesting is to read the Supplement Facts and ingredients list. From a testing perspective, the meaningful question becomes: which metabolites does your test panel target? For example, a workplace 5-panel test (common in the US) often targets:
– THC-COOH (from cannabis)
– Cocaine metabolite (benzoylecgonine)
– Opiate metabolites (e.g., morphine/codeine pathway)
– Amphetamine/methamphetamine metabolites (varies by assay)
– Benzodiazepine metabolites (if included in a specific panel)

Urine is the most commonly used matrix for drug testing because it can reflect recent use via drug metabolites.
Hair testing generally has a longer retrospective window because drugs can incorporate into hair as it grows.
Urine tests: usually the “days not weeks” scenario
Urine drug screens are designed to detect metabolites excreted through the urinary system. That usually means days to about a week for many substances after last use—though THC can be longer, particularly with frequent/chronic use. In current practice, urine testing often includes:
– Immunoassay screening (fast, presumptive)
– Confirmatory testing (commonly GC/MS or LC/MS/MS), when required
According to Substance Abuse and Mental Health Services Administration (SAMHSA), urine testing relies on comparing metabolite concentrations to specific cutoff levels (e.g., THC, cocaine, opiates, amphetamines), and cutoffs determine whether a result is reported as positive or negative (2017–2020 reporting standards).

Blood and saliva: shorter windows, different biology
Blood testing typically detects a shorter timeframe for most drugs because it reflects more immediate presence and bioavailability. While some testing programs use blood (or oral fluid) for specific contexts (e.g., impairment-related policies), these modalities still depend on the drug and its pharmacokinetics.
Hair: longer and less forgiving for repeated use
Hair testing can extend detection windows substantially because drug metabolites can be incorporated during hair formation. If a scenario involves hair (often 30–90 day segments, depending on protocol), “detox” approaches are typically far less effective for changing the outcome.
Quick comparison: what usually changes by test type
| Test Type | Typical Retrospective Window (General) | What It Detects Mostly | Practical Takeaway |
|---|---|---|---|
| Urine | Days to ~1 week (sometimes longer for THC) | Metabolites excreted in urine | Most common; timing matters |
| Blood | Hours to days | Parent drug/bioactive levels | Short window; context-specific policies |
| Saliva / Oral fluid | ~1–3 days (often substance-dependent) | Recent use markers | Less common than urine in workplaces |
| Hair | Weeks to months | Metabolites as hair grows | “Cleanse” products rarely shift results reliably |

Use pattern: single vs repeated dosing
One of the strongest predictors of detection time is your last-use timing and whether usage was one-time or repeated. Repeated use can lead to more metabolite accumulation and longer washout times.
– Single use: metabolite peaks and clears faster
– Frequent use: metabolites may persist at detectable levels longer
– Chronic heavy use: THC metabolites can be notably prolonged compared to other drug classes
Body composition and hydration
Body fat percentage can matter because many drugs are lipophilic (fat-soluble). Hydration influences urine dilution, but dilution doesn’t guarantee a negative result—some tests flag dilute specimens, and confirmatory lab workflows can still find metabolites.

Metabolism and kidney function
Metabolism affects how quickly enzymes process a drug into metabolites and how quickly the body excretes them. Kidney function, routine health, and even sleep patterns can influence clearance rate.
Q: Can hydration alone make a positive drug test become negative?
Not reliably—urine dilution can reduce concentration, but metabolite presence and laboratory cutoff logic still determine the result, and some programs reject or flag dilute samples.
Medication interactions and test cutoffs
Some medications can alter metabolism (CYP enzyme activity), indirectly affecting metabolite profiles. Additionally, different testing panels and cutoff values change outcomes even when two people have similar usage histories.
Typical Detection Windows (General Estimates)
Herbal Clean-related timing is usually measured in days, but the accurate expectation comes from the substance class and the urine test’s cutoff. For most substances, many people see urine detectability fall within 1–3 days, while heavier or repeated use can extend detectability to a week or longer.
In urine testing, detection windows are substance-specific because each drug produces different metabolites with different clearance rates.
THC metabolites often persist longer than many other drug classes, especially with frequent or high-dose cannabis use.
According to National Institute on Drug Abuse (NIDA), detection timeframes vary by drug and testing matrix, and THC is frequently among the longest-lasting in urine for many users (Drug Facts / detection guidance). Detection windows are also heavily influenced by the individual’s use frequency and assay sensitivity.
Data snapshot: common urine detection estimates after last use
> Note: These are general estimates for single to moderate use patterns and can extend with repeated/heavy use. Labs may use different cutoffs and confirmatory methods.
General Urine Detection Windows by Drug Class (US Common Cutoffs)
| # | Drug Class / Common Target Metabolite | Typical Urine Detectability (Days) |
Typical Range for Many Users (Days) |
Relative Expectation (Timing) |
|---|---|---|---|---|
| 1 | Opiates (morphine/codeine pathway) | 1–3 | Up to ~4 | Quicker clearance |
| 2 | Cocaine (benzoylecgonine) | 2–4 | Often ≤5 | Short window |
| 3 | Amphetamines (e.g., methamphetamine metabolite) | 1–3 | Up to ~4–5 | Typically days |
| 4 | Benzodiazepines (varies by drug) | 3–7 | Up to ~10 | More variable |
| 5 | PCP (phencyclidine metabolite) | 3–7 | Sometimes up to ~14 | Can run longer |
| 6 | Methadone (metabolites) | 3–6 | Occasionally longer | Moderate window |
| 7 | Cannabis (THC-COOH) | ~1–3 | Up to ~30 (heavy use) | Longest variability |
These ranges align with commonly cited medical/detection guidance; however, the most conservative plan is to assume the test could detect longer than the minimum estimate.
